Since device IDs and cross-signing keys occupy the same namespace, clients must
|
||||||
|
ensure that they use the correct keys when verifying. While servers must not
|
||||||
|
allow devices to have the same IDs as cross-signing keys, a malicious server
|
||||||
|
could construct such a situation, so clients must not rely on the server being
|
||||||
|
well-behaved and should take precautions against this. For example, clients
|
||||||
|
should refer to keys using the public keys rather than only by the device
|
||||||
|
ID. Clients should also fix the keys that are being verified, and ensure that
|
||||||
|
they do not change in the course of verification. Clients may also display a
|
||||||
|
warning and refuse to verify a user when it detects that the user has a device
|
||||||
|
with the same ID as a cross-signing key.
